I don't like starting with Air Man because I find the Lightning Lords are so much easier to deal once you have Metal Blade.

And I like having Flash Stopper before Metal Man's level because it makes getting through the Presses faster since you can just stop them from dropping and run on through.

And if I'm getting Flash Stopper first, I might as well hit up Quick Man before Metal Man, too, since Metal Man is weak to the boomerangs, and it's a really fast stage to complete once you've memorized the beam patterns and can save the Flash Stopper for Quick Man himself.

And I don't need anything for Flash Man's stage, so I just go ahead and start with him.

Guts Man is also very easy to beat with the arm cannon (arguably easier that way than with Hyper Bombs, honestly), and you don't need any special weapons to help get through his stage, either, so starting with him, and then doing Cut > Elec is far more efficient to avoid back-tracking (and you do kill Cut Man even faster when you can throw rocks at him).

That said, if you don't mind the back-tracking and are having fun, then it doesn't matter what order you go in. Although I fear those who would start with Ice Man or Fire Man. lol
